14. State-Specific Rights
California Residents (CCPA)
California residents have additional rights under the California Consumer Privacy Act, including:
Right to know what personal information is collected and how it's used
Right to delete personal information
Right to opt-out of the sale of personal information
Right to non-discrimination for exercising these rights
European Union Residents (GDPR)
EU residents have rights under the General Data Protection Regulation, including:
Right to access, rectify, and erase personal data
Right to restrict or object to processing
Right to data portability
Right to lodge a complaint with supervisory authorities
